Madison, Wisconsin is a vibrant and diverse city located in the heart of the Midwest. As the capital of Wisconsin, Madison is known for its rich history, beautiful lakes, and exciting cultural scene.

Madison is situated on an isthmus between two stunning lakes, Lake Mendota and Lake Monona, which provide a picturesque backdrop for the city. The University of Wisconsin-Madison, one of the top public universities in the country, is located in the heart of the city, giving Madison a youthful and energetic atmosphere. The university also contributes to the city’s reputation as a center for arts, culture, and education.

One of the most iconic landmarks in Madison is the Wisconsin State Capitol building, which is the centerpiece of the downtown area. The Capitol is home to the state’s government and is a stunning example of the Beaux-Arts architectural style. Visitors can take guided tours of the building to learn about its history and significance.

Madison is also known for its thriving arts and music scene. The Overture Center for the Arts is a world-class performing arts venue that hosts a variety of shows, concerts, and events throughout the year. The city is also home to numerous art galleries, theaters, and music venues, showcasing the talents of local and international artists.

For outdoor enthusiasts, Madison offers a plethora of recreational opportunities. The city is surrounded by miles of hiking and biking trails, and the lakes provide ample opportunities for water activities such as boating, fishing, and swimming. In the winter, the nearby ski resorts and cross-country skiing trails attract outdoor enthusiasts from across the region.

Madison also has a reputation for being a foodie’s paradise, with a wide array of restaurants, cafes, and farmers’ markets offering delicious cuisine and locally-sourced ingredients. The city’s diverse population has contributed to its thriving food scene, with restaurants serving everything from traditional Midwestern fare to international cuisine.

In conclusion, Madison, Wisconsin is a dynamic and welcoming city with a rich culture, stunning natural beauty, and a wide range of activities for residents and visitors alike. Whether you’re interested in history, the arts, outdoor recreation, or culinary delights, Madison has something to offer for everyone.
